Dream Machine

Dream Machine is Luma AI's video generation model that produces high-quality, physically consistent video clips from text and image inputs. Built on Luma's expertise in 3D reconstruction and neural radiance fields, Dream Machine generates videos with particularly strong spatial understanding and object consistency. It has gained popularity for its ability to create visually compelling short videos with coherent motion and lighting.

Claude Opus 4

Claude Opus 4 is Anthropic's most powerful AI model, holding the #1 position on the Chatbot Arena leaderboard. It represents a breakthrough in extended thinking and agentic capabilities, able to work autonomously on complex multi-step tasks for hours. With a 200K token context window, it excels at analyzing entire codebases, lengthy legal documents, and research papers in a single pass. The model demonstrates exceptional performance in coding (setting new benchmarks on SWE-bench), advanced reasoning, and nuanced writing tasks. Its agentic capabilities allow it to use tools, navigate computers, and execute multi-step workflows with minimal human oversight. Opus 4 is the preferred choice for enterprises requiring the highest quality output on mission-critical tasks where accuracy and depth matter more than speed or cost.
